Psalm 70:13 Douay-Rheims

Let them be confounded and come to nothing that detract my soul; let them be covered with confusion and shame that seek my hurt.

George Leo Haydock

1774–1849 Catholic

Detract. Hebrew, “are satans,” or “adversaries,” during my trial. The Fathers say these are predictions, Psalm xxxiv. 4. (Calmet) — David certainly wished to spare the chief of the rebels, and he most probably speaks of his spiritual enemies. (Berthier)
